496,160 is a composite number, even.
496,160 (four hundred ninety-six thousand one hundred sixty) is an even 6-digit number. It is a composite number with 48 divisors, and factors as 2⁵ × 5 × 7 × 443. Its proper divisors sum to 846,496,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x79220.
